redis 是一款基于内存存储的高性能缓存框架,支持多种数据结构如string, hash, list, set、sorted set、bitmap等多种数据类型,也提供了很多高可用功能如rdb和aof备份、哨兵模式和集群模式部署。redis有许多的应用场景,一般用于替代一些数据库访问热点数据操作减少数据库压力以及提高性能,也可用于session共享、排行榜等。redis是业内最流行的一款缓存框架,使用的非常频繁。
![55cc1b666730a26648b07e7d53d5ee9c.png](https://img-blog.csdnimg.cn/img_convert/55cc1b666730a26648b07e7d53d5ee9c.png)
redis
一些主流的开源框架也很好的集成了redis,Spring生态下的Spring Data系列集成了Redis,使用起来非常方便。Spring Data系列还拥有许多方便使用的项目。
![f4c9152235da9cca0d1c4f7bce560237.png](https://img-blog.csdnimg.cn/img_convert/f4c9152235da9cca0d1c4f7bce560237.png)
Spring Data系列
下面介绍下在springboot中Spring Data Redis的简单使用。
简单三步集成。
1.加入maven依赖
org.springfra